Transaction 4851fa96ca960d67e03eeb4e78eb8870f9e26ebccfa655c9ba7aa93b053a9193
1 Input
1 Output
-
4851fa96ca960d67e03eeb4e78eb8870f9e26ebccfa655c9ba7aa93b053a9193:0
- value
- 511415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ddc18afed24848cade3b8d21596bd3a5c2531909 OP_EQUAL
- address
- 3MuZ7YAvK13Bfr2g9qdYsfGxyeTEQk9LmF